We just got a 2008 29bhbs

we used it a couple weeks ago, worked well. we knew it wasnt a high end trailer, but it is functional and has lots of room, a feature we were looking for. the bathroom is small, we hope the bathroom door will be a nice feature but we didnt use much on our first trip. the shower is pretty small, limited head room without the skylight, but ok if you arent over 6 ft or so. our bathroom was totally functional though. we werent able to get anything to stick to the walks effectively so we will have to screw our towel rings and mounting hooks in the wall. It is a good solid trailer, very heavy.

all the major items worked fine. the drawers arent too substantial, dont pull hard on them they will hangup and damage. be careful when you open the drawers, lift and pull, they are friction slides not rollers.

the trailer has lots of internal and external storage. our heat and air worked well. all appliances worked well. no problems during the 315 mile tow to the cg.

fyi, regarding plumbing. the kitchen sink and bathroom sink are connected to galley, they fill quickly, i think they are about 33 gall tank. shower is connected to gray tank , 33 gall i think. black tank to commode. also a city water tank, well insulated

awning worked fine, but due to wind didnt use

ran out of water quickly, onlly used the propane heat, not electric, it is a 6 gall dsi/elect/propane suburban. would recommend adding the water conservation head in shower that has the water off feature

very roomy, plenty of lighting, stereo and tv worked fine, the flip tv is a nice feature. recommend added a 4 inch memory foam to bed for comfort.

slides worked fine. just keep gears and metal lubricated with slide spray, and use seal spray on the rubber seals on the slides and they should work for a long time. the slide switches are next to light switches so a cover may be needed to prevent accidental slide switching when turning lights on /off, there doesnt seem to be any fuses or breakers to switch off in the panel box inside. the on/off for the water heater is also in a bad location and needs a cover, this is pretty common in trailers though not just FR

we didnt get a rear ladder unfortunately so we bought an extend and climb ladder, works well

the dinette is nice size, the table is a bit cheap, the hinges pulled out of our frame already, not a big deal though, when we get time we will try to see how to fix.

Hope you have a good dealer, spend a lot of time doing research up front, on the quality of the trailer and the dealer you buy from.
